在 Android 设备上,我们可以使用一系列命令行指令来管理 Wi-Fi。本文将详细介绍如何使用这些命令来打开、关闭、连接和扫描 Wi-Fi 网络。
1. 打开和关闭 Wi-Fi
打开 Wi-Fi:
bash
cmd wifi set-wifi-enabled enabled
关闭 Wi-Fi:
bash
cmd wifi set-wifi-enabled disabled
2. 查看 Wi-Fi 状态
使用以下命令查看 Wi-Fi 当前状态:
bash
cmd wifi status
输出示例:
已关闭:
Wifi is disabled
Wifi scanning is always available
已打开,未连接:
Wifi is enabled
Wifi is not connected
已连接到网络:
Wifi is enabled
Wifi is connected to "Project2"
3. 扫描 Wi-Fi 网络
开始扫描:
bash
cmd wifi start-scan
获取扫描结果:
bash
cmd wifi list-scan-results
结果示例:
BSSID Frequency RSSI Age(sec) SSID
98:97:cc:50:f6:bf 5240 -90 4.404 NW-DQA-FYH_5G1
54:75:95:ff:f2:ec 5805 -89 4.404 WCS-DQA6-ZR-5G
...
4. 连接 Wi-Fi
要连接到特定 Wi-Fi(例如:名称为 Project2
,密码为 12345678
),使用以下命令:
bash
cmd wifi connect-network Project2 wpa2 12345678
5. 查看已保存的网络
使用以下命令查看已保存的 Wi-Fi 网络:
bash
cmd wifi list-networks
示例输出:
Network Id SSID Security type
1 Project2 wpa2-psk
2 Project2 wpa3-sae
6. 忘记网络
要忘记某个已保存的网络,使用:
bash
cmd wifi forget-network <networkId>
示例:
bash
cmd wifi forget-network 1
7. 开启/关闭 Wi-Fi 热点
开启热点:
bash
cmd wifi start-softap hotpot11 wpa2 12345678
关闭热点:
bash
cmd wifi stop-softap
8. 自动开启 Wi-Fi
开启自动扫描:
bash
cmd wifi set-scan-always-available enabled
关闭自动扫描:
bash
cmd wifi set-scan-always-available disabled
查看状态:
bash
cmd wifi status
以上是对 Android Wi-Fi 操作命令的详细介绍。希望这能帮助你更好地管理你的 Wi-Fi 连接。如有任何问题,请随时联系我!